I'd imagine the steel rims have the same offset as the alloys. As they are the same size tyre. Looks like there are some stampings on the rim, but photo not higher enough res to read. Anyone with an SZ4 might be able to see if the ET is stamped on the face of the rim.

I can't see running an ET00 rim instead would make a huge difference. 5mm is pretty small in context.

The et information is usually stamped on the inside of the wheel either by the mounting face or on the back of a spoke much like it is on an alloy one.
